Maharashtra was gearing up for a series of major infrastructure inaugurations this week, including the highly anticipated Samruddhi Mahamarg and Mumbai Metro Line 3. These projects were expected to transform connectivity and daily commuting for millions. However, all scheduled events have now been postponed due to a nationwide security alert following the recent terror attack in Pahalgam, Jammu and Kashmir.

The decision to delay the events was taken as a precautionary measure. With the central and state intelligence agencies on high alert, large public gatherings and high-profile events have been temporarily suspended. Officials confirmed that while the developments are ready, their launch has been pushed until further notice in the interest of public safety.
One of the headline projects affected is the Samruddhi Mahamarg – a 701-km expressway connecting Mumbai and Nagpur. The expressway, constructed at a cost of around ₹55,000 crore, aims to reduce travel time between the two cities to under eight hours. It is also expected to boost trade, tourism, and regional development across multiple districts in Maharashtra.
The Samruddhi Mahamarg inauguration notice has left many awaiting the road’s official opening disheartened. Nevertheless, the government maintains that the safety of attendees and dignitaries cannot be compromised.

The inauguration of Mumbai Metro Line 3, also known as the Colaba–Bandra–SEEPZ corridor, has been impacted too. This fully underground line is poised to ease congestion on local trains and reduce road traffic across South and Central Mumbai.

Along with the metro and expressway, several other projects across the state, ranging from bridges to flyovers and public facilities, have also been delayed.
The attack in Pahalgam has triggered tightened security measures across India. In Maharashtra, police forces and intelligence units are operating at full capacity. Security protocols around VIP movements and public events have been revised.
Officials have assured that new dates for the inaugurations will be announced once the security situation stabilises. For now, the Samruddhi Mahamarg inauguration postponed update reflects a cautious but necessary approach to protect public safety.
